This volume offers man} novel topics, including:
•
Safety evaluation of new pharmaceutical compounds
•
Surveillance and regulator} guidelines
(US and
OECD)
•
Novel models for reproductive and developmental
toxicit}
testing
•
In ritro and in vivo
biomarkers
of developmental
toxicit}
testing
•
Micro-CT, PET, ultrasound, and other imaging technologies
•
Maternal-fetal biocommimicarion, pharmacokinetics,
and PBPK modeling
•
Stem cell research, toxicosenomics, and metabolomics
•
Oxidative stress, cell signaling mechanisms, and
mitochondria! dvsrunction
•
Irnmunotoxicity,
neuroinflammation,
and
neurodeveloprnental
toxicit}
•
Mutagenicity, carcmogenicity, teratogenicin; and infertility
•
Placenta! structure, function, transporters, fetal
programming, and pathology
•
Drags of abuse and addiction
•
Pharmaceuticals and nutraceuticals
•
Pesticides, metals, mycotoxins, prntotoxins, and zootoxins
•
Radiation, engineered nanopamcles, bisphenol A,
phthalates, and melamine
•
Endocrine disruptors and their screening systems
•
Domestic, wildlife, and aquatic reproductive and
developmental toxicology
